Elba Mccalister
Showing 1 to 1 of 1 resultsElba celebrated 64th birthday on June 1. Elba’s current address is 907 Scott Str, Columbus, OH 43222-1232. We know that Mustafa Alnajjar, Lewis L Craft, and ten other persons also lived at this address, perhaps within a different time frame
Main Address
- 907 Scott St, Columbus, OH 43222
- County: Franklin County
- Neighborhood: Franklinton
- FIPS: 390490043002077
- Possible connections via main address - Mustafa Alnajjar, Lewis L Craft
- Latitude, Longitude: 39.960448, -83.025142
ads by BeenVerified